Rusty Truck

I have always wanted to photograph a rusty truck laying on a farmers land somewhere, but I was not expecting to find one on Kangaroo Island. This truck was in the front yard of a souvenir shop in the middle of nowhere. I used a rather inexpensive Sony kit lens, but the results are great.
